Output 59e6dd293af02dfadc26b17dae2313bbea5e71604a5f80c55eaf66a629830ecd:1

value
3555921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1706fe1f6f8512f6aa28885eaa7131bb358a4c9 OP_EQUAL
address
3PhdU38QQxvuTyCFomUV1NBp7ddYsJLUmY
transaction
59e6dd293af02dfadc26b17dae2313bbea5e71604a5f80c55eaf66a629830ecd